Why Burkina Faso Needs Solar Energy Solutions
With 2,600 hours of annual sunshine, Burkina Faso's solar potential remains largely untapped. Only 45% of the population currently enjoys grid electricity access, creating urgent demand for renewable alternatives.
| Indicator | Current Status | 2030 Target |
|---|---|---|
| National Electrification Rate | 45% | 95% |
| Renewable Energy Share | 18% | 50% |
| Average Daily Solar Radiation | 5.5 kWh/m² | |
Three Key Advantages of Photovoltaic Systems
- Reduced reliance on imported fossil fuels
- Low maintenance requirements in arid climates
- Scalable solutions for urban and rural areas

Case Study: 20MW Solar Farm in Ouagadougou
This flagship project demonstrates photovoltaic technology's urban potential:
- Generates power for 30,000 households
- Integrated battery storage for night supply
- Hybrid system combining fixed and sun-tracking panels
Future Trends in Burkina Faso's Solar Sector
Emerging technologies are reshaping the market:
- Bifacial solar panels increasing yield by 15-20%
- AI-powered cleaning systems reducing dust impact
- Mobile payment solutions for rural energy access

FAQs: Solar Energy in Burkina Faso
What's the payback period for solar installations?
Typically 4-6 years for commercial systems, thanks to high sunlight availability and rising electricity costs.
How does weather affect panel performance?
Modern panels maintain 85% efficiency even at 40°C - perfect for Burkina Faso's climate.
